The transgender pride flag. Dlloyd based on Monica Helms design via Wikimedia Commons Designed by Monica Helms, the transgender flag was first shown at a pride parade in Phoenix, Arizona in 2000.
LGBTQ+ Pride Month, held each June, is an observation of queer culture through celebration and protest. It commemorates the 1969 Stonewall Uprising.
